Understanding Breast Pumps: Types and Benefits

Breast pumps are essential tools for many breastfeeding mothers, offering the flexibility to provide breast milk when direct breastfeeding is not possible. There are various types of breast pumps available, including manual, electric, and battery-operated models. Manual pumps require hand operation, making them a convenient and affordable choice for occasional use. Electric pumps, on the other hand, offer more efficiency and are ideal for regular use. They come in single or double options, allowing mothers to pump one or both breasts simultaneously. Battery-operated pumps provide portability and ease of use, perfect for on-the-go situations. The benefits of using a breast pump extend beyond convenience, as they help maintain milk supply, relieve engorgement, and allow others to feed the baby, providing mothers with much-needed rest.

Choosing the Right Breast Pump for Your Needs

Selecting the appropriate breast pump depends on individual needs and lifestyle. For mothers who plan to pump occasionally, a manual pump might suffice. However, those who intend to pump regularly, such as working mothers, may find electric pumps more suitable due to their efficiency and ease of use. Additionally, considering factors like portability, noise level, and ease of cleaning can influence the decision. Consulting with a lactation consultant or healthcare provider can provide personalized recommendations based on specific breastfeeding goals and challenges.
